Output 20e764239cab3af150e1517c24c400df3fa0dcb0fbc2d6b1bcb7cd9fc7094b60:0

value
842737
script pubkey
OP_0 OP_PUSHBYTES_20 163721446eb8100e6b629221a5f3bd8943b20b39
address
bc1qzcmjz3rwhqgqu6mzjgs6tuaa39pmyzeejc753y
transaction
20e764239cab3af150e1517c24c400df3fa0dcb0fbc2d6b1bcb7cd9fc7094b60
confirmations
42451
spent
true